LSB support for Red Hat Linux
http://www.linuxfoundation.org/collaborate/workgroups/lsb
The Linux Standard Base (LSB) is an attempt to develop a set of standards that will increase compatibility among Linux distributions. The redhat-lsb package provides utilities needed for LSB Compliant Applications. It also contains requirements that will ensure that all components required by the LSB that are provided by Red Hat Linux are installed on the system.
